[0001] This utility model relates to the field of heat exchange structure technology, and in particular to a multi-layer hollow cylindrical evaporator heat exchange structure. Background Technology

[0002] In the field of MVR (Mechanical Vapor Recompression) evaporator technology, the heat exchanger, as a key component, directly affects the efficiency and stability of the entire evaporation system. With the increasing demands for evaporation efficiency and energy conservation in industry, how to increase the heat exchange area and improve heat exchange efficiency has become a critical issue that urgently needs to be addressed in the MVR evaporator technology field. Traditional MVR evaporator heat exchanger designs are often limited by structural form and spatial layout, resulting in a relatively small heat exchange area, making it difficult to achieve efficient heat transfer within a limited space. This limitation not only restricts the evaporator's processing capacity but may also lead to low energy utilization efficiency and increased operating costs. Especially when processing high-concentration, high-viscosity, or easily crystallizing materials, heat exchangers with small heat exchange areas are more prone to clogging and scaling, further affecting the normal operation and service life of the evaporator. [0040] The following will describe in detail the implementation of this application with reference to the accompanying drawings and embodiments, so that the implementation process of how this application uses technical means to solve technical problems and achieve technical effects can be fully understood and implemented accordingly.

[0041] Please refer to Figures 1 to 8As shown, an embodiment of this utility model provides a multi-layer hollow cylindrical evaporator heat exchange structure, including: an outer layer structure 1, a middle layer structure 2 and an inner layer structure 3 coaxial with the outer layer structure 1 are sequentially arranged inside the outer layer structure 1, and the outer layer structure 1 and the middle layer structure 2 and the middle layer structure 2 and the inner layer structure 3 are interconnected by a connecting structure 4.

[0042] By adopting the above technical solution, and by setting an outer structure 1, a middle structure 2, and an inner structure 3, and connecting the three with several connecting pipes 401-4011-402, a multi-layer, three-dimensional heat exchanger structure is constructed, which significantly increases the heat exchange area and thus improves the heat exchange efficiency. The increased heat exchange area allows the heat exchanger to transfer more heat in the same amount of time, increasing the heat exchange capacity, accelerating the evaporation process, improving processing capacity, and reducing energy consumption, thereby achieving energy conservation and emission reduction. At the same time, the multi-layer structure design allows the refrigerant to be distributed and flow more evenly in the heat exchanger, reducing system instability. The increased heat exchange area can also reduce material blockage and scaling, extend the service life of the heat exchanger, and enhance system stability and reliability.

[0043] In order to construct the outer hollow shell, in this embodiment: the outer structure 1 includes two outer plates 101 and two outer sealing plates 1011. The ends of the two outer plates 101 are sealed and connected by the outer sealing plates 1011 to form a hollow shell. By forming the outer hollow shell, a basic space is provided for the flow and heat exchange of fluids such as refrigerant, ensuring the integrity of the heat exchanger outer structure 1, which is the basis for constructing the entire multi-layer heat exchanger structure.

[0044] In order to achieve communication between the outer layer and the internal structure, in this embodiment, a plurality of outer layer communication holes 102 are provided on the outer layer sealing plate 1011 located at the top. The outer layer communication holes 102 provide an interface for the subsequent connection of the connecting pipe and the outer layer structure 1, so that refrigerant and the like can smoothly enter the internal structure from the outer layer structure 1. This is a key step in realizing fluid exchange between the multi-layer structure.

[0045] In order to enable fluid to enter and exit the outer structure 1, in this embodiment: a water inlet pipe 103 and a drain pipe 1031 are sequentially installed on the outer connecting hole 102 located at the bottom.

[0046] In order to construct the middle hollow shell, in this embodiment: the middle structure 2 includes two middle plate 201 and two middle sealing plate 2011, and the two ends of the two middle plate 201 are sealed and connected through the middle plate 201 to form a hollow shell. The construction of the middle hollow shell further enriches the hierarchical structure of the heat exchanger, provides more flow paths and heat exchange space for fluids such as refrigerant, and helps to improve heat exchange efficiency.

[0047] In order to achieve communication and coordination between the middle layer and the outer and inner layers, in this embodiment, both middle layer sealing plates 2011 are provided with middle layer communication holes 202 that cooperate with the outer layer communication holes 102. The middle layer communication holes 202 cooperate with the outer layer communication holes 102 to allow refrigerant and other fluids to flow smoothly between the outer and middle layer structures 2, ensuring the continuity of fluid exchange between the multi-layer structures, which is the key to building an efficient heat exchange channel.

[0048] In order to construct the inner hollow shell, in this embodiment: the inner structure 3 includes two inner plate 301 and two inner sealing plates 3011, and the two ends of the two inner plate 301 are sealed and connected by the inner sealing plates 3011 to form a hollow shell. The construction of the inner hollow shell improves the multi-layer structure of the heat exchanger, provides the final heat exchange space for fluids such as refrigerant, and makes the entire heat exchanger structure more complete and efficient.

[0049] In order to achieve communication and coordination between the inner layer and the middle layer, in this embodiment, both inner layer sealing plates 3011 are provided with inner layer communication holes 302 that cooperate with the middle layer communication holes 202. The inner layer communication holes 302 and the middle layer communication holes 202 cooperate to allow refrigerant and other fluids to flow smoothly between the middle layer and the inner layer structure 3, further ensuring the continuity of fluid exchange between the multi-layer structure and helping to improve heat exchange efficiency.

[0050] To achieve communication between the outer layer and the middle layer, and between the middle layer and the inner layer, in this embodiment: the communication structure 4 includes a first connecting pipe 401 and a second connecting pipe 4011. The outer layer communication hole 102 is connected to the middle layer communication hole 202 on the middle layer sealing plate 2011 at the bottom of the middle layer plate 201 through the first connecting pipe 401. The middle layer communication hole 202 on the middle layer sealing plate 2011 at the top of the middle layer plate 201 is connected to the inner layer communication hole 302 on the inner layer sealing plate 3011 at the bottom of the inner layer plate 301 through the second connecting pipe 4011. The communication between the outer layer, middle layer and inner layer structure 3 is achieved through the first connecting pipe 401 and the second connecting pipe 4011, thus constructing a complete fluid flow channel. This allows fluids such as refrigerant to flow in an orderly manner between the multi-layer structure, greatly improving the heat exchange efficiency.

[0051] To achieve direct communication between the outer and inner layers, in this embodiment, the communication structure 4 further includes a connecting pipe 402, and the outer layer communication hole 102 is connected to the inner layer communication hole 302 on the inner layer sealing plate 3011 at the top of the inner layer plate 301 through the connecting pipe 402. The outer and inner layers are directly connected through the connecting pipe 402, which increases the path and mode of fluid flow, further optimizes the fluid distribution in the heat exchanger, and helps to improve the heat exchange area and heat exchange efficiency.

[0052] The working principle of this invention is as follows: By cleverly arranging an outer layer structure 1, a middle layer structure 2, and an inner layer structure 3, and utilizing several connecting pipes 401 between the outer layer structure 1 and the middle layer structure 2, several connecting pipes 4011 between the middle layer structure 2 and the inner layer structure 3, and several connecting pipes 402 between the outer layer structure 1 and the inner layer structure 3, the various layers are tightly and orderly connected. This design, without changing the size of the heat exchanger, cleverly alters the refrigerant carrier structure, allowing the refrigerant to flow and exchange heat fully between the multiple layers, greatly increasing the heat exchange area, thereby significantly improving the heat exchange capacity and effectively enhancing the overall performance of the heat exchanger.
